    Why "It Was Nice Speaking With You" Works:

    This phrase is effective because it's:

    • Polite and respectful: It acknowledges the other person's time and contribution to the conversation.
    • Concise and professional: It avoids rambling or unnecessary pleasantries.
    • Versatile: It's suitable for various contexts, from formal business interactions to casual conversations.
    • Positive and appreciative: It conveys a sense of gratitude and leaves a positive feeling.

    Beyond the Basics: Enhancing Your Closing

    While "It was nice speaking with you" is a strong foundation, you can enhance it by adding subtle touches:

    • Personalization: Instead of a generic closing, consider adding a personal touch relevant to the conversation. For example, "It was nice speaking with you, I look forward to seeing your presentation next week" or "It was nice speaking with you, I'll follow up on that project proposal as discussed."
    • Specificity: Highlight a specific aspect of the conversation you enjoyed. For example, "It was nice speaking with you, I especially appreciated your insights on the marketing strategy."
    • Call to action (where appropriate): In professional contexts, you might add a call to action. For example, "It was nice speaking with you, I'll send over the documents as promised." or "It was nice speaking with you, I look forward to scheduling our next meeting."

    Alternative Closing Phrases:

    While "It was nice speaking with you" is excellent, sometimes a slight variation might be more appropriate:

    • Formal: "It was a pleasure speaking with you."
    • Informal: "Great talking to you!" or "Thanks for your time!"
    • Business-focused: "Thanks for your valuable input." or "I appreciate you taking the time to speak with me."
    • After Problem Solving: "I'm glad we could resolve that issue. Thanks for calling."

    The Importance of Context:

    The best closing phrase depends on the context of your conversation. Consider:

    • The relationship with the person: A close friend might receive a more casual closing than a potential client.
    • The nature of the conversation: A serious business discussion requires a more formal closing than a casual chat.
    • Your overall goal: If you aim to continue the conversation, your closing should reflect that.
